Black and Ambers are out in front

-

NEWPORT ........................ 28 SWANSEA ........................ 10

NEWPORT went top of Principali­ty Premiershi­p Tier Two following their bonus-point victory over Swansea – and scrum-half Ryan James says things are finally starting to click.

The Black and Ambers were fully deserving of their victory at a sunbaked Rodney Parade which they earned thanks to tries from full-back Llywarch ap Myrddin, centre Chay Smith, No.8 Rhys Jenkins and replacemen­t back Matt O’Brien, with fly-half Arwel Robson banging over four conversion­s.

“We are very happy to be at the top and we are starting to build some momentum now after our slow start to the season,” said James.

It was a bad-tempered encounter saw the hosts’ captain and lock Andrew Brown and Swansea flanker Jack Perkins yellow carded for fighting in the first half, the latter fortunate not to see red for a punch.

Swansea loosehead Tom Sloane soon joined Perkins in the sin bin for scrapping while Newport’s Jenkins and Rhys Williams of Swansea were binned in the second half.

Replacemen­t hooker Paul John scored the Swansea try in the second half, converted by Laurence Howley to add to Josh Martin’s penalty.

“We are disappoint­ed because we put in a lot of effort and played with a lot of endeavour,” said All Whites director of rugby Richard Lancaster. Scorers – Newport – Tries: L ap Myrddin, C Smith, R Jenkins, M O’Brien; Cons: A Robson (4). Swansea – Try: P John, Con: L Howley; Pen: J Martin. Man of the Match: (Newport) Arwel Robson
